Failures retry with exponential backoff for 24 hours, after which events land in the dead-letter table. Current backlog and retry rates are on the delivery dashboard; the weekly sync should review dead-letter counts and any subscribers consistently timing out. Replaying dead-lettered events requires the replay CLI, which marks rows as requeued to avoid duplicates. To query the dead-letter table or audit replay history, connect using the connection string below.

replica DSN, yahog-kawig: redis://istox_svc:um@db-8a67.halixforge.test:5432/frawyn

CI note: the Harborlake partition-migration job fails when a test database lacks a partition for the current month. The fixture seeder now pre-creates partitions three months ahead. If support sees this failure again, confirm the runner picked up the seeder update by checking the build token below.

trace token, fafog-kageg: htk4_98e6

Step 3: Turn on payload compression for the Tindervale telemetry agents. Heads up — this is the step people usually fumble. The collector already accepts compressed frames, so you just need to flip the agents over and pick a sane batch size; too big and you'll blow the ingest buffer on the Harrowmere nodes. Test one fleet first. When you're ready, drop in these values.

config for kafof-bawef:
holath:
  log_level: debug
  metrics_host: metrics.holath.qorvelsys.internal
  pin: 2191
  pool_size: 32

Onboarding note for the weekly eng sync: Paylark retries failed charge attempts up to three times, and every retry must carry the same idempotency key so the processor deduplicates correctly. Keys are generated per checkout session in the Ledgerline service and stored alongside the order record. Never regenerate a key mid-retry; that causes double charges. The signing secret used to mint keys lives in the service env file, on the line below.

vault entry, yahif-yajep: COURIER_KEY29=b802bdf8034096b65a51c6ba5abe2